From d2f685eed74fb7b345bf1a75b6023d62d86a1a52 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: nobu Date: Mon, 18 Dec 2017 07:15:07 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] io.c: opening external command * io.c (rb_io_open_generic): try to open the named file as usual, if klass is not IO nor File, so that Errno::ENOENT will be raised probably. calling on File will be same in the future.
